Maeda Gin
Gin Maeda is a Japanese actor. He had a regular role in the Otoko wa Tsurai yo films, beginning with the first in the series, as Sakura's husband.

Uehara Misa
Uehara Misa appeared in a few Japanese films from the late 1950s, most notably starring as Princess Yuki in Kurosawa Akira's The Hidden Fortress. Following a brief career, she left acting. (Source: Wikipedia)
Ebara Tatsuyoshi
Ehara Tatsuyoshi is a Japanese actor and businessman from Tokyo. He is a graduate of Keio University. In 1948, he appeared as a child actor in "Kane no Naruoka". After that, he joined Toho and worked as a youth star.
Koseki Yuji
Koseki Yuji was a Japanese ryūkōka, gunka, march, fight song and film score composer, known for his elegant and prestigious style. It is said that he composed 5,000 songs during his lifetime, many of which are still loved.
